Draft Notes:

The list of players listed for this draft round are complete, however, profile information for each player becomes more scarce from 2001 to 1965.

The best player drafted is based solely on the signed player who played in the most games at the highest level. (Pitchers games are adjusted) It is not a subjective view of who TBC believes was the best player.

Schools in bold indicate that the player was the first player ever drafted from this school.
